    I really wanted to like this camera but looks like I will have to return it. I'm a dedicated Kodak camera user and recently bought this one as an upgrade to an old one that experienced water damage. The camera itself is well made, thin and easy to use as expected. Shutter speed is excellent as always. However compared to other kodak cameras bought in the past the picture quality is just not that great. Close up shots tend to come out great. However any photo in which I had to zoom is definitely not what I expected. Also the display screen images are very grainy compared to display screens on previous Kodak cameras I owned. Honestly for 130 dollars you can't really complain too much. However as a dedicated Kodak camera user I prefer and expect better picture quality. Now I'm tempted to purchase the Canon 1400is which my sister recently purchased and picture quality is excellent.

    This is a very good camera for the price. I have owned two of them. I gave the first one away as a gift after having it for about 7 months, and immediately bought another one for myself again. I paid less for the 2nd one, which I bought here at Amazon. The first one I bought at Office Depot for $80.00, which was still a great price, and Amazon's price was even better.

    I only find two minor faults with the camera. The first one is that the button for turning the camera on and off and the one for snapping photos are the same size and are side by side, which sometimes causes one to shut the camera off when you meant to snap a photo, or you snap a photo when you meant to shut it off.

    The second problem is that the instruction manual is practically useless. It's so vague on some things and does not even mention others. When I had my first camera I ran into a problem where it would shut off when I connected it to the computer via USB cord to download photos. It would just shut off completely. No where in the instruction manual could I find any reason why. Finally, by trial & error I discovered that the microSD card had to be formatted by the camera. The option for this is found under "configurations". THIS IS NOT EVEN MENTIONED IN THE INTRUCTION MANUAL! Once I formatted the camera never gave me trouble, and I recently bought another card, a 32GB microSD card for it. I went into "configurations", formatted it, and all's well.

    Aside from that, the camera is great, and it takes video of a quality that's equal to a camcorder. I've never had a digital cam that takes quality video until this camera. Every other digital camera I've had in the past took great photos, but the video was of inferior quality. Not so with the Kodak M590. The video quality is crystal clear and in MP4 format.
